Abstract

The present invention relates to methods and kits for diagnosing multiple sclerosis (MS) in a subject. Particularly, the present invention relates to methods and kits for diagnosing a subtype of MS in a subject, the subtype selected from relapsing-remitting MS (RRMS), secondary progressive MS (SPMS), primary progressive MS (PPMS) and a pathologic sub-type of MS lesions selected from Pattern I and Pattern II MS lesion.

Claims (25)

1. A method of diagnosing a subtype of multiple sclerosis (MS) in a subject, the method comprising determining the reactivity of antibodies in a sample obtained from the subject to a plurality of antigens selected from the group consisting of the antigens listed in Tables 1 to 4, thereby determining the reactivity pattern of the sample to the plurality of antigens, and comparing the reactivity pattern of said sample to a control reactivity pattern, wherein the subtype of MS is selected from the group consisting of:

(i) relapsing remitting multiple sclerosis (RRMS) wherein said plurality of antigens comprises at least 5 different antigens selected from the group consisting of the antigens listed in Table 1;

(ii) primary progressive multiple sclerosis (PPMS) wherein said plurality of antigens comprises at least 5 different antigens selected from the group consisting of the antigens listed in Table 2;

(iii) secondary progressive multiple sclerosis (SPMS) wherein said plurality of antigens comprises at least 5 different antigens selected from the group consisting of the antigens listed in Table 3; and

(iv) a pathologic subtype of MS selected form Pattern I lesions and Pattern II lesions wherein said plurality of antigens comprises at least 5 different antigens selected from the group consisting of the antigens listed in Table 4;

wherein said plurality of antigens is used in the form of an antigen array comprising a glass support, wherein determining the reactivity of antibodies in the sample to the plurality of antigens is performed using a system providing quantitative measurement of antigen-antibody binding by fluorescence detection, and wherein a significant difference between the reactivity pattern of said sample obtained from the subject compared to a reactivity pattern of a control sample is an indication that the subject is afflicted with the subtype of MS.

2. The method of claim 1 , wherein the glass support is an epoxy glass support.

3. The method of claim 2 , wherein each antigen is attached to at least three separate specific addressable locations of the array.

4. The method of claim 1 for diagnosing relapsing remitting multiple sclerosis (RRMS) in a subject, wherein the plurality of antigens are selected from the antigens listed in Table 1 and the control reactivity pattern is obtained from healthy subjects.

5. The method of claim 1 , wherein each antigen is attached to at least three separate specific addressable locations of the array.

6. The method of claim 4 , wherein the plurality of antigens comprises all the antigens listed in Table 1.

7. The method of claim 1 , for diagnosing primary progressive multiple sclerosis (PPMS) in a subject, wherein the plurality of antigens are selected from the antigens listed in Table 2 and the control reactivity pattern is obtained from healthy subjects.

8. The method of claim 7 , wherein the plurality of antigens comprises all the antigens listed in Table 2.

9. The method of claim 1 for diagnosing secondary progressive multiple sclerosis (SPMS) in a subject, wherein the plurality of antigens are selected from the antigens listed in Table 3 and the control reactivity pattern is obtained from RRMS subjects.

10. The method of claim 9 , wherein the plurality of antigens comprises all the antigens listed in Table 3.

11. The method of claim 1 for diagnosing Pattern I lesions in a subject with MS, wherein the plurality of antigens is selected from the antigens listed in Table 4 and the control reactivity pattern is obtained from subjects having Pattern II lesions.

12. The method of claim 1 for diagnosing Pattern II lesions in a subject with MS, wherein the plurality of antigens is selected from the antigens listed in Table 4 and the control reactivity pattern is obtained from subjects having Pattern I lesions.

13. The method of claim 1 , wherein the control is selected from the group consisting of a sample from at least one individual, a panel of control samples from a set of individuals, and a stored set of data from control individuals.

14. The method of claim 1 , wherein the sample is a serum sample.

15. The method of claim 1 , further comprising diluting the sample 1:10 before determining the reactivity of antibodies in the sample.

16. The method of claim 1 , wherein the subtype of MS is selected from the group consisting of:

(i) relapsing remitting multiple sclerosis (RRMS) wherein said plurality of antigens is HSP70 511-530, HSP60 286-305, LACTOCEREBROSIDE, AB1-42 and AB1-12, listed in Table 1;

(ii) primary progressive multiple sclerosis (PPMS) wherein said plurality of antigens is Chondroitin 4-Sulfate, Neurofilament 68 kDa, Amyloid Beta, Secreted APPalpha and SOD, listed in Table 2;

(iii) secondary progressive multiple sclerosis (SPMS) wherein said plurality of antigens is HSP60 376-395, Amyloid beta 1-23, HSP70 601-620, Cardiolipin and beta Crystallin, listed in Table 3; and

(iv) a pathologic subtype of MS selected from Pattern I lesions and Pattern II lesions wherein said plurality of antigens is 15-ketocholestane, 15α-hydroxycholestene, 15-ketocholestene, Brain L-α-lysophosphatidylserine and 160 kDa. Neurofilament, listed in Table 4.
